The CLARITY Act — the bill that would set federal rules for how crypto is regulated — is up for a possible Senate vote this week. That's the headline. What isn't clear is almost everything else.

Senate Banking Chair Tim Scott is pushing hard to get a vote before the Senate leaves for its next break, and he's framed the path forward simply: get Republicans lined up first, then bring Democrats aboard. The bill already cleared the Senate Banking Committee back in May on a 15-9 vote, with two Democrats crossing over to support it.

But a committee vote isn't a floor vote. To actually pass, the bill needs 60 votes — meaning at least eight Democrats have to come aboard, on top of the two who already crossed over. And it's not just a Democrat problem: Senator Josh Hawley has said he'll oppose the bill over concerns from community banks about deposit flight tied to stablecoin yields, and Senator Thom Tillis has said he'll vote no unless a bipartisan ethics provision gets resolved first.

So here's where things actually stand: nobody knows if there's a vote this week at all, let alone whether it passes, gets delayed to September, or stalls entirely. Anyone telling you with confidence which way this goes is guessing. We're not going to pretend otherwise.

Intrinsic Value

What a company is actually worth based on what it owns — not what its stock happens to be trading for today.

Net Asset Value, or NAV

The total value of everything a company owns, divided by the number of shares. It's the per-share worth of the company's actual assets.

The Formula

Number of ETH held × ETH price = Asset-Backed Value

This asset-backed value is the intrinsic value.

Market Premium

The difference between what a stock is trading for and what it's actually worth based on its assets. If the market pays more than the asset-backed value, that's a premium. If it pays less, that's a discount.

Market NAV, or mNAV

A way of measuring that premium or discount as a multiple. If a stock trades at 2× mNAV, the market is paying twice the company's asset-backed value for each share.

Why It's Used

Because these companies rarely trade at exactly their asset-backed value. The market pays more or less depending on how investors feel about the company's strategy, its growth, and its future — not just what it owns today. Using a range of multiples lets us show what the stock could be worth under different levels of investor enthusiasm, instead of pretending there's only one right answer.

How It Should Be Understood

As a range of possibilities, not a prediction. A wider range between the low and high multiple means more uncertainty about how the market will price the stock — not that one outcome is more likely than another.

Staking

The process of putting your ETH to work securing the Ethereum network, instead of just holding it in a wallet doing nothing.

Think of it like a savings account. When you deposit cash in a bank, the bank puts that money to work and pays you interest in return. Staking works similarly: you lock up your ETH to help the Ethereum network verify transactions, and in exchange, the network pays you a reward — in ETH.

The key difference from a bank: there's no bank in the middle. The reward comes directly from the Ethereum protocol itself, and the "work" your ETH is doing is helping run the network's core security system.

Staking Yield

The reward you earn for staking your ETH, paid out in more ETH.

If staking is like a savings account, staking yield is the interest rate. Instead of your bank depositing $5 into your account every month, the Ethereum network deposits a small amount of additional ETH into your staked position on an ongoing basis.

For a company holding ETH as a treasury asset, this matters because it means the ETH pile can grow on its own — without buying more ETH, without raising capital, and regardless of what ETH's price is doing that day. It's a second way the treasury grows, separate from "the price of ETH went up."

Why BMNR and SBET Stake Their ETH

Both companies could simply buy ETH and hold it in a wallet, waiting for the price to rise. Instead, they stake nearly all of it. Here's why that choice matters.

They're not just betting on price — they're building a compounding machine. A company that only holds ETH is making one bet: that ETH goes up in value. A company that stakes its ETH is making that same bet, plus collecting a steady stream of additional ETH along the way. Every year the treasury grows a little on its own, on top of whatever the price does.

It's the difference between a piggy bank and a savings account. Buying and holding ETH is a piggy bank — the value only changes if the price of what's inside changes. Staking turns that same pile of ETH into a savings account that pays you more ETH just for keeping it there. Same ETH, same risk from price swings, but one version is working for you and the other isn't.

It signals long-term intent, not short-term trading. To stake ETH, a company generally has to commit to holding it for a meaningful period — it isn't a strategy built for something you plan to sell next week. When a company stakes the overwhelming majority of its treasury, it's a visible, disclosed statement that management sees itself as an owner and operator of ETH exposure over the long run, not a trader looking to flip it at the next price spike.

The reward doesn't come from the market — it comes from the network. Staking rewards aren't paid by another investor buying the stock, and they don't depend on Wall Street's mood that day. They're paid directly by the Ethereum protocol for helping keep the network secure. That makes it a source of growth that isn't tied to the same forces that move the stock price day to day.
